About Saint Willibald of Eichstätt
Willibald was an eighth-century English monk and unusually well-traveled pilgrim whose journeys included Rome, the Holy Land, and Constantinople. After monastic years at Monte Cassino, he joined Saint Boniface’s mission in German lands and became the first bishop of Eichstätt. His dictated travel account preserves a rare early pilgrim’s testimony.
